探秘 Web 小工具:特性、部署与优势
1. 小工具与微件:概念辨析
在探讨 Web 小工具时,常有人会将其与 Web 微件混淆。实际上,二者本质上并无太大区别,主要差异在于运行该微型应用的平台不同。一些供应商称其客户端应用为小工具,而另一些则称之为微件。
相对而言,“小工具”这个词更为合适,它离线定义为小巧便捷的设备,恰如其分地比喻了 Web 小工具。而“微件”对于不太熟悉该技术的人来说,含义较为模糊,甚至有些难以理解。此外,“微件”还有许多不相关的定义,比如许多智能手机平台提供的低级用户界面控件。在后续讨论中,主要使用“小工具”这一术语,但二者可互换使用。
2. 小工具的特性
- 基于 Web 技术 :小工具是基于 Web 的应用,它采用标准的 Web 开发技术,如 XHTML、CSS 和 JavaScript。这意味着 Web 开发者无需学习新的知识,就能运用小工具技术。借助 JavaScript 和网络连接,还能使用 Ajax 技术,为小工具带来更多可能性。同时,开发者喜爱的 CSS 或 JavaScript 库也能在小工具中使用。不过需要注意的是,目前 Flash、Silverlight 等插件在移动浏览器上的支持有限,如果要部署到智能手机,应尽量避免使用这些技术。
- 体积小巧 :小工具的视觉尺寸通常较小,高度和宽度一般不超过几百像素,有时甚至更小。这对视觉设计产生了明显影响,图形通常会减到最少,字体也会缩小到最小可读尺寸。在布局方面,为了容纳更多内容,小工具的内容常被分成不同的页面或板块。此外,由于尺寸限制,小工具的功能必须精简,专注于核
超级会员免费看
订阅专栏 解锁全文
17

被折叠的 条评论
为什么被折叠?



